Transaction 2e648634b5e5fed98ff3cf9349a181ac52a48f809e1c4988c33adbd545011f50

1 Input
2 Outputs
  • 2e648634b5e5fed98ff3cf9349a181ac52a48f809e1c4988c33adbd545011f50:0
  • value  350000
    address  12ru7ec2q5VMNevuKaYcZMMqzWUBN5zHFq
  • 2e648634b5e5fed98ff3cf9349a181ac52a48f809e1c4988c33adbd545011f50:1
  • value  3312515
    address  3PfPSQ93eGwTk3w4yAsSCMxW6RLnkyZL8E